Inventor of Salt automation project comes up with a new way to tame cloud complexity


Cloud complexity is nothing new. Solving for it has been an intractable challenge.

Cloud-indigenous applications centered on microservices can have countless numbers of transferring areas and application application interfaces. Although that’s built application advancement a lot quicker and much more trustworthy, it is also launched a dizzying internet of interconnectedness.

The challenge of figuring out what’s liable for a slowdown or outage has presented beginning to a $17 billion marketplace for log monitoring and cloud observability resources. However, a new survey commissioned by Gigamon Inc. observed that 99% of info know-how gurus reported their team has missed or failed to satisfy a provider-degree arrangement because of overly complex cloud infrastructure, and 96% said cloud complexity or network functionality bottlenecks have slowed migration initiatives.

VMware’s Tom Hatch: “The core issue with the cloud is scaling people today.” Photograph: LinkedIn

Tom Hatch has occur up with a new tactic to observability and automation that he desires to share with the entire world. Hatch, who is director of engineering at VMware Inc. and creator of the Salt open up-resource project that is widely made use of to automate infrastructure configuration and management, believes that instead of writing scripts to automate events in the cloud, cloud companies ought to do far more of their individual automation. His freshly launched Idem Venture scans present-day cloud deployments and generates knowledge that can be utilized to set off remediation gatherings with tiny human intervention.

Idem’s automation code is composed in the commonly used Python language and designed to be modular and extensible. “The runtime execution is just 35 strains of code,” Hatch said in a video interview recorded at SaltConf past drop. Idem has been correctly analyzed on the 3 greatest U.S. cloud platforms as perfectly as on GitHub.

Individuals never scale

“The only way we will prevail over the web-site dependability engineering crisis is by rethinking the method,” Hatch mentioned in an interview with SiliconANGLE. “We want to turn the procedure on its head and make it a lot simpler to deal with cloud assets.”

Operators are turning out to be confused with info and unable to maintain up with the development and complexity. “The authentic bottlenecks occur again to men and women,” Hatch explained in the movie interview. “The core trouble with the cloud is scaling individuals.”

Idem, which launched very last thirty day period less than an Apache open-supply license, is named for the mathematical time period “idempotent,” which refers to an element of a set that doesn’t alter in price when multiplied or or else operated on by alone. Idempotence is used in programming to confirm that services conduct persistently below distinctive operational situations.

As beneficial as Salt is, it was produced for considerably less elaborate environments than the kinds that are prevalent in the cloud today. “Salt was about controlling [virtual machines],” Hatch stated in a video job interview recorded at SaltConf last fall. “It’s a ton far more difficult now.” Idem is described as a companion to and not a alternative for Salt.

Outdoors-in approach

Idem takes benefit of the ubiquitous use of application method interfaces to faucet into cloud assets and glance for anomalies. “The main constructs are motivated by Salt but we have expanded it quite a bit,” Hatch said. “It’s idempotent useful resource management: know exactly where the source is, its state and the parameters that are appropriate to it. Make it so the automation strategy is geared toward receiving the observability we have to have and right away apply the observation deck to motion.”

The objective is for code to be vehicle-created instead of written by hand. “The fundamental operate establishes the state of the resource, what desires to be altered and can make the changes,” he said. “The conclude-user does not want to deal with scripts.”

Idem is at present currently being maintained within VMware but there is the chance it could be moved less than the oversight of an impartial exterior business, Hatch stated. “We’re operating on going a important volume of VMware infrastructure to Idem,” he reported. “We needed to develop a universal details extraction technique that can make ingestion less complicated in just VMware products and solutions. Making it open up source guarantees that it’s generalized.”

The upcoming item on the project’s agenda is to acquire an method to performing with top secret data such as Safe Shell Protocol keys. “We have a pipeline we’ll deliver in a couple of weeks,” Hatch explained. “Beyond that, a good deal of our operate will be about supporting additional APIs and clouds.”

Photo: Unsplash

Show your guidance for our mission by signing up for our Cube Club and Cube Celebration Neighborhood of industry experts. Join the community that consists of Amazon Website Products and services and CEO Andy Jassy, Dell Systems founder and CEO Michael Dell, Intel CEO Pat Gelsinger and several far more luminaries and professionals.


Source website link